A BRITISH CONVOY ATTACKED.
I iTHE ENEMY REPULSED
LONDON, December 7.
Five hundred men belonging to De la Bey's force determinedly attacked a convoy proceeding from Pretoria to Rustenburg, at Duffel's Poort, on the 3rd.
The escort consisted of 25 Victorians mounted, with two guns of the 75th Battery, and two companies bf the West Yorkshires.
Details show that the Yorkshire Light Infantry, west of the kopjes, fought with great gallantry. The Boers entered the first half of the convoy and burnt a wagg-on. General Broadwood is sending assistance.
The Boers dispersed on, the 4th. They suffered heavily, some being Hlled-by case shot 50 yards from.the guns. The British.,had 15 killed and 23 bounded.
